Add helper pass to remove llvm.dbg.declare intrinsics.
[oota-llvm.git] / lib / Support / Dwarf.cpp
index b7cf3b977abd7efa716012de4b026a777bb3ae03..67bd1b44a1fdcad1bce785d2a7a0942624ad22d6 100644 (file)
@@ -198,6 +198,10 @@ const char *AttributeString(unsigned Attribute) {
     case DW_AT_GNU_vector:                 return "DW_AT_GNU_vector";
     case DW_AT_lo_user:                    return "DW_AT_lo_user";
     case DW_AT_hi_user:                    return "DW_AT_hi_user";
+    case DW_AT_APPLE_optimized:            return "DW_AT_APPLE_optimized";
+    case DW_AT_APPLE_flags:                return "DW_AT_APPLE_flags";
+    case DW_AT_APPLE_major_runtime_vers:   return "DW_AT_APPLE_major_runtime_vers";
+    case DW_AT_APPLE_runtime_class:        return "DW_AT_APPLE_runtime_class";
   }
   assert(0 && "Unknown Dwarf Attribute");
   return "";